Nice Bible, even if a basic hardback cover, content and NLT is wonderful.
I also ordered this is a beautiful soft cover Bible, where the cover is so pretty and smooth/soft. This will be a review essentially of both. They were identical on the inside. I found from a few nights of using the soft back cover that the spine wasn't recovering well from being opened. I don't know if it would have have failed eventually, but that was also my concern of the hardback version too, that the spine covering of the hardback would crack. Also know, this is a thick and heavy Bible. The soft cover is flexible and requires you to hold it carefully so as to not let it flex too much and get away from you. The hardback was a little easier to handle. Overall, I chose to keep the hardback for it's ease in holding and the cheaper price. Regarding the content, the NLT translation is wonderful - my first time reading NLT and I'm definitely a fan, coming off of KJV and NKJV. I love the study content, although I'm still learning how best to use all of the info. I do admit that I first read my NKJV (a personal challenge to touch every page in that NKJV Bible) and then I move over and re-read it in the NLT. Of course this takes quite a bit of time to read it twice, then the study notes. For now, I'll continue, but I can easily see myself setting aside my NKJV for this one.

Concise Reading with Lessons to Practice
I remember trying to read the Bible when I was younger and how difficult it was to try and make sense, I believe it was the King James Version.Now that I'm older, I wanted to try again. I used a website that allows you to compare translations and came upon the NLT for my preference. Following that, I read some reviews of different NLT Bibles on Amazon and picked this one.This Bible is very concise and easy to read. It flows very smoothly. The applications are lessons taken from the scriptures that define how we can use them in everyday life. Furthermore, the introductions, footnotes, maps, and other notes aid in giving a complete perspective of the time and situations.I recommend this Bible, but the only gripe I have is that it is not as large print as one would think, compared to other large print Bibles.
